End of airport hell

(Dr Bug) Rescue from airport hell came in the form of brother Tim sitting patiently in the baggage claim area in Ontario CA. He took us back to his house, with a warm welcome, a soft bed and perfectly cooked steak dinner.

This morning it was fresh mangos and apple/pear/orange juice fresh from the juicer.

Around 11am Tim drove us up to Idlywild to meet our ride to Lake Morena. We got a lift from a 2006 thru-hiker named Trawler from Truckee, CA. This weekend is a traditional gathering of past and present thru hikers. Enroute to lake morena we drove through some of the first areas we will be hiking through. Trawler shared his memories and experiences from last year. He also stopped to pick up another hiker,Out of Order. He is hiking with all borrowed gear. His was lost by USAir when he flew from th east.

The terraine at Lake Marina is much greener and the plants more diverse than we were expecting. Some of the plants we're seeing are Mesquite, sage brush, poppies and a type of oak we ae not familiar with. Tomorrow we will get a ride to Campo for the start of our hike. Lake Morena is 20 miles from the southwestern terminous of the trail.
